16:05 — Security review confirmed the root cause: the Thornquay font vendoring script fetched the Brindlemark typeface from an external mirror during CI rather than from our pinned internal archive, bypassing checksum verification. The mirror had served a modified file for roughly six hours. We quarantined affected artifacts, restored the pinned copy, and added a hard failure when the vendored checksum mismatches. The first clean rebuild after remediation carries the identifier shown below.

build token for bajog-baduf: htk21_9e2b5b4fb45699971ce35

INTERNAL MEMO — Branch Managers, Aldervane Appliances

Re: Warranty-Cost Overrun, Q3

Warranty claims on the Frostline chiller range have exceeded forecast by 18%, concentrated in units shipped from the Merrowgate plant. Engineering has traced the fault to a compressor seal batch. Branches should log all related claims under the dedicated code and hold affected stock pending inspection. The appended note is confidential.

board note of kafog-bajep: Briathek Partners is in early talks to buy Aldaelek Group for about $47.1 million. The Ulaath launch date is September 4, and nothing goes to the press before then.

INTERNAL MEMO — Colden Ridge Field Clinic Supply. To the warehouse shift lead: two medical coolers (vaccine stock, temperature-logged) leave with the Tuesday van for the Colden Ridge clinic. Coolers must be loaded last and unloaded first; transit time must not exceed four hours. Check the data loggers are running before the doors close and note the reading on the manifest. Clinic staff will verify seals on arrival before signing. Do not leave the coolers unattended at any point. The courier hand-over instruction follows below.

dispatch memo: the eliath belael courier leaves the praox ledger at gate 8841 under passcode 017589

Capacity note for the Bramblewick export retry queue. Failed exports are requeued with exponential backoff, and the queue depth is our main capacity signal: sustained depth above the high-water mark means downstream Pellis storage is saturated, not that we need more workers. As the new contractor, please don't raise worker counts without checking storage latency first — it usually makes things worse. Retry timing, backoff caps, and the high-water threshold are all driven by the constants shown below.

limits module of yagef-bajog:
TIERS = {
    "druael": 370,
    "tamix": 286,
    "pelius": 541,
    "pelael": 78,
    "pelox": 47,
    "ralath": 533,
    "drumir": 801,
}